Mount Washington is a city in Bullitt County, in the Louisville metro area.
Mount Washington is in the Bluegrass region.
First named for Mount Vernon for George Washington's home in VA, but because there was another community with that name, it was changed to Mount Washington.
The latitude of Mount Washington is 38.05N. The longitude is -85.545W.
It is in the Eastern Standard time zone. Elevation is 705 feet.The estimated population, in 2003, was 8,605.
